‘= =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= =

‘                       Go to User-Defined Demand Distance

‘= =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= =

Private Sub Axis1_RunDist_Click()

Dim BinaryAxisOne_PosDem(1 To 25) As Byte

BinaryAxisOne_PosDem(1) = &H1

BinaryAxisOne_PosDem(2) = &H13

BinaryAxisOne_PosDem(3) = &H15

BinaryAxisOne_PosDem(4) = &H2

BinaryAxisOne_PosDem(5) = &H0       ‘Write Motion Command Interface

BinaryAxisOne_PosDem(6) = &H2       ‘Write Motion Command Interface

BinaryAxisOne_PosDem(7) = CByte(“&H” + “1” + CStr(MyRnd()))             ‘(7)個位數 need to change every time

BinaryAxisOne_PosDem(8) = &H1        ‘011xh:VAI Increment Dem Pos

BinaryAxisOne_PosDem(9) = CByte(“&H” + format16(Axis1_dist, 0, 0)   ‘(9)-(12):  Position Increment

BinaryAxisOne_PosDem(10) = CByte(“&H” + format16(Axis1_dist, 0, 1)  ‘(Lowest_MiddleLow_MiddleHigh_Highest)

BinaryAxisOne_PosDem(11) = CByte(“&H” + format16(Axis1_dist, 0, 2))

BinaryAxisOne_PosDem(12) = CByte(“&H” + format16(Axis1_dist, 0, 3))

BinaryAxisOne_PosDem(13) = CByte(“&H” + format16(Axis1_vel, 1, 0)   ‘(13)-(16): Max Velocity

BinaryAxisOne_PosDem(14) = CByte(“&H” + format16(Axis1_vel, 1, 1))

BinaryAxisOne_PosDem(15) = CByte(“&H” + format16(Axis1_vel, 1, 2))

BinaryAxisOne_PosDem(16) = CByte(“&H” + format16(Axis1_vel, 1, 3))

BinaryAxisOne_PosDem(17) = CByte(“&H” + format16(Axis1_acc, 2, 0))    ‘(17)-(20): Acceleration

BinaryAxisOne_PosDem(18) = CByte(“&H” + format16(Axis1_acc, 2, 1))

BinaryAxisOne_PosDem(19) = CByte(“&H” + format16(Axis1_acc, 2, 2))

BinaryAxisOne_PosDem(20) = CByte(“&H” + format16(Axis1_acc, 2, 3))

BinaryAxisOne_PosDem(21) = CByte(“&H” + format16(Axis1_dec, 2, 0)   ‘(21)-(24): Deceleration

BinaryAxisOne_PosDem(22) = CByte(“&H” + format16(Axis1_dec, 2, 1))

BinaryAxisOne_PosDem(23) = CByte(“&H” + format16(Axis1_dec, 2, 2))

BinaryAxisOne_PosDem(24) = CByte(“&H” + format16(Axis1_dec, 2, 3))

BinaryAxisOne_PosDem(25) = &H4

MSComm1.Output = BinaryAxisOne_PosDem

End Sub

‘= =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= =

‘                         Positive Demand Position 3 mm

‘                   MaxVel= 0.1m/s; Acc= 1m/s^2; Dec= 1m/s^2;

‘—————————————————————————————————-

‘                                ** Parameter **

‘   (1): Fix ID telegram start (&H1)

‘   (2): Destination node ID (MACID)

‘   (3): Telegram length

‘   (4): Fix ID start data (&H2)

‘   (5): Message Sub ID

‘   (6): Message Main ID

‘   (7): Motion Cmd Intf Header Low Byte   (count)

‘   (8): Motion Cmd Intf Header High Byte

‘   (9)-(12):  Position Increment   (Lowest_MiddleLow_MiddleHigh_Highest)

‘   (13)-(16): Max Velocity         (Lowest_MiddleLow_MiddleHigh_Highest)

‘   (17)-(20): Acceleration         (Lowest_MiddleLow_MiddleHigh_Highest)

‘   (21)-(24): Deceleration         (Lowest_MiddleLow_MiddleHigh_Highest)

‘   (25): Fix ID telegram end (&H4)

‘= =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= = =

Private Sub AxisOne_PosDemPos_3_Click()

Dim BinaryAxisOne_PosDem(1 To 25) As Byte

BinaryAxisOne_PosDem(1) = &H1

BinaryAxisOne_PosDem(2) = &H13

BinaryAxisOne_PosDem(3) = &H15

BinaryAxisOne_PosDem(4) = &H2

BinaryAxisOne_PosDem(5) = &H0        ‘Write Motion Command Interface

BinaryAxisOne_PosDem(6) = &H2        ‘Write Motion Command Interface

‘BinaryAxisOne_PosDem(7) = &H1F     ‘個位數 need to change every time

BinaryAxisOne_PosDem(7) = CByte(“&H” + “1” + CStr(MyRnd()))

BinaryAxisOne_PosDem(8) = &H1         ‘011xh:VAI Increment Dem Pos

BinaryAxisOne_PosDem(9) = &H30

BinaryAxisOne_PosDem(10) = &H75

BinaryAxisOne_PosDem(11) = &H0

BinaryAxisOne_PosDem(12) = &H0                               ‘

BinaryAxisOne_PosDem(13) = &HA0

BinaryAxisOne_PosDem(14) = &H86

BinaryAxisOne_PosDem(15) = &H1

BinaryAxisOne_PosDem(16) = &H0

BinaryAxisOne_PosDem(17) = &HA0

BinaryAxisOne_PosDem(18) = &H86

BinaryAxisOne_PosDem(19) = &H1

BinaryAxisOne_PosDem(20) = &H0

BinaryAxisOne_PosDem(21) = &HA0

BinaryAxisOne_PosDem(22) = &H86

BinaryAxisOne_PosDem(23) = &H1

BinaryAxisOne_PosDem(24) = &H0

BinaryAxisOne_PosDem(25) = &H4

MSComm1.Output = BinaryAxisOne_PosDem

End Sub
